news 2026/4/30 21:05:29

8、深入了解 Linux 系统:文件系统、系统控制与常用命令

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
8、深入了解 Linux 系统:文件系统、系统控制与常用命令

深入了解 Linux 系统:文件系统、系统控制与常用命令

1. Linux 文件系统概述

Linux 文件系统为用户提供了强大而灵活的文件管理能力。在文件名和目录名方面,它允许使用长达 255 个字符的名称,空格是允许的,但应避免使用标点或特殊字符,不过“_ – .”除外。由于 Unix 最初仅支持 7 位字符集,使用该范围之外的字符(如德语变音符号)可能会出现问题,因此在使用时需检查应用程序是否能正确处理这些字符。虽然不强制限制使用 a - z、A - Z、0 - 9 和“-”,但这样做是明智的。

Linux 文件系统不遵循 DOS 系统中常见的三字符文件扩展名规则,并且区分大小写,例如“Text1”和“text1”是不同的文件。目录和文件之间使用斜杠“/”作为分隔符,反斜杠“\”是不允许的,它是用于控制功能的转义字符。

在 Linux 中,用户不能像在 DOS 或 Windows 9x/NT 中那样直接通过程序名调用当前目录下的程序,因为用户 shell 不会首先在当前目录中查找指定的命令,而是仅评估系统路径。不过,Linux 支持使用“.”表示当前目录,“~”表示用户主目录。

以下是一些常见的文件类型标识:
| 标识 | 说明 |
| ---- | ---- |
| .rc | 配置文件(通常以点开头) |
| .c, .cc | C 或 C++ 程序文本 |
| .f | Fortran 程序 |
| .tar | tar 磁带存档 |
| .gz | 用 gzip 压缩的文件 |
| .tmp | 临时文件 |
| .profile | 用户登录脚本(使用 ba

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 3:29:46

ESP芯片身份识别难题:3步掌握UID读取与修改完整方案

ESP芯片身份识别难题:3步掌握UID读取与修改完整方案 【免费下载链接】esptool 项目地址: https://gitcode.com/gh_mirrors/esp/esptool 你是否曾在设备管理中遇到这样的困境:面对几十台相同的ESP设备,却无法准确识别每一台的身份&…

作者头像 李华
网站建设 2026/4/25 21:55:59

VideoPipe:轻量级C++视频分析框架的革命性突破

一、介绍 VideoPipe 是一个用于视频分析和结构化的 C框架,依赖性极小且易于使用。它像管道一样运行,每个节点都是独立的,可以以多种方式组合。 VideoPipe 可用于构建不同类型的视频分析应用,适用于视频结构化、图像搜索、人脸识别…

作者头像 李华
网站建设 2026/4/18 22:44:26

Windows开发者的福音:MinGW-w64极速配置完全指南

Windows开发者的福音:MinGW-w64极速配置完全指南 【免费下载链接】mingw-w64 (Unofficial) Mirror of mingw-w64-code 项目地址: https://gitcode.com/gh_mirrors/mi/mingw-w64 MinGW-w64作为Windows平台最强大的开源编译器套件,为C/C开发者提供了…

作者头像 李华
网站建设 2026/4/26 9:15:30

教育场景应用:用GPT-SoVITS生成个性化教学语音

教育场景应用:用GPT-SoVITS生成个性化教学语音 在一间普通的中学教室里,一位物理老师刚结束一堂关于牛顿定律的讲解。课后,几个学生围在平板前回放课程录音——但这次播放的不是课堂实录,而是由AI生成、却完全复刻了老师音色的教学…

作者头像 李华
网站建设 2026/4/20 2:29:04

pyecharts-assets终极部署指南:打造高速可视化体验

pyecharts-assets终极部署指南:打造高速可视化体验 【免费下载链接】pyecharts-assets 🗂 All assets in pyecharts 项目地址: https://gitcode.com/gh_mirrors/py/pyecharts-assets pyecharts-assets作为pyecharts图表库的本地静态资源解决方案&…

作者头像 李华
网站建设 2026/4/29 0:32:17

OpenRGB终极指南:一站式解决多品牌RGB设备灯光控制难题

还在为电脑上不同品牌的RGB设备需要安装多个控制软件而烦恼吗?华硕主板、海盗船内存、雷蛇键盘、罗技鼠标...每个厂商都要求使用自己的专属应用,不仅占用系统资源,还经常出现兼容性冲突。OpenRGB开源项目应运而生,通过逆向工程实现…

作者头像 李华